Working as/alongside these (massive) names is how Dutch Electronic Music Legend Benno de Goeij slowly made a name for himself as one of the finest Producers to ever walk this Earth. The past 27 years saw him reach several musical heights such as the three Golden Records for his work as Rank 1 (Airwave, Superstring (Rank 1 Remix) & Awakening) as well as earning a Grammy nomination alongside Trance Royalty Armin van Buuren and singer Trevor Guthrie for the massive hit 'This Is What It Feels Like' in 2013. But Benno is a man of many talents, as much commercial success as he might have had, he's can snap his fingers at any moment and drop a sudden Underground, Pure Electronic Love Letter like he did as part of GAIA in 2018-2019 for the incomparable Moons Of Jupiter live show and album. Yup, odds are if you've followed the Trance scene closely for the past few decades, you've probably heard, danced to and/or enjoyed something that Benno (co-)created. The Dutch stadium-size Anthem Trance sound would simply not have been what it is today without this man. And from September 2024 onward, the illustrious list of iconic projects he's partaken in will be expanded with a brand new entry.

Dear people, meet BnO!


I was quite surprised to see Benno tweet that he was launching a brand alias. It's something I had hoped would happen back in 2013 when I had the opportunity to chat with him! But here we are today, a new outlet for us to enjoy some tasty De Goeij music!  First, a bit of context. Unbeknownst to myself (yes I know, SHAME!), Benno and Lulleaux (/Hugo Prick) had already worked before on a few of the latter's 2017 and 2018 tracks like Contact (with Giang Pham), Tourist (with Patrick Baker), On My Lockscreen (with Attizz), Lovin' (with Glen Faria), On The Go (with Dwight Steven), Missing You (with NEIMY) and You Look Like (Sex). Benno announced he had been exploring new musical directions and The Quest (wink wink ;)) l.e.d. (okay okay I'll stop xD) to the  emergence of BnO. So what exactly did The Maestro cook for us?

01. Lulleaux, BnO & SEM - Take Me Away (Extended Mix)

The original kicks off with a very bouncy House-based bassline before it gets layered with a catchy pluck remniscint in sound of In Petto's - Toca Me. Pads swell gently in the background as this pluck takes centre stage. Then Sem Rozendaal's vocal kicks in, showering us in a nostalgic mood about good times long gone before belting out the track's title with power and melancholy. What strikes me is how the track goes from mellow and summery to slightly sad and melancholic at 01:44 when the Take Me Away's main melody is teased in the background. SEM's "Oh ohhs" in the background strengthen that homesick feeling. By the time the second verse hits, the rather playful intro vibe has made way for a full blown sense of wanting to be elsewhere. Damn, I didn't quite expect this track to hit me with the nostalgic feels! A very nice tune here, mellow in execution but surprisingly strong in emotion. 02. Lulleaux, BnO & SEM - Take Me Away (Club Mix)

The club mix starts off with more energy though this version also has a bit of a subdued execution to it. This time a gentle piano eases us into SEM's vocals. The moment he sings Take Me Away, a very '90s sounding main lead swells backed by trademark rolling De Goeij snares as the drop hits us with nostalgia of a different kind: the Club Mix takes me away to another era and in the process puts a big smile on my face. I'm not sure how these guys pulled it off but that slight sadness from the original isn't present in this version. If the original is about being sad that you are where you are in life or in love, the club mix is about the thrill of being on the road, on a journey, on that ride to that somewhere else SEM refers to. It's crazy what an altered main hook and different synth sound can do for the overall mood of a track. I gotta say I dig this one a lot too! Damn you three, well done! :D

My only question in regards to this mix is... Why is it so Spotify-oriented?? The Club Mix could easily be 5 to 6 minutes long, it's too good to be so short! Curiously I only spotted the Club Mix on Beatport and Junodownload, it hasn't popped up on Spotify yet so I hold hope that means an Extended Club Mix will be released as well.

In conclusion

If you like your Electronic music mellow, with a sprinkle of late summer vibes and a good dash of powerful vocal longing for an escape, this is just the cocktail you need for your playlists. The Extended Mix goes for a bit of sadness, whilst the Club Mix goes for a more euphoric touch. The original's catchy hook and bouncy build make it a nice tune to relax to whilst the Club Mix beefs it up in all the right places without losing out on the late-summery feeling that makes the original so enjoyable. And what can I say, I am just a sucker for the Club Mix' '90s Club vibe. :D

Oh, while we're at it, might I recommend Lulleaux - On My Lockscreen too? A sweet melancholic, dreamy tune that fits with the ethos of Take Me Away despite going for a very different approach sound wise. It already proved in 2017 that Hugo and Benno make a pretty good team.
